An exciting opportunity has arisen for a dynamic and skilled School Football Coordinator to join the Western Sydney Wanderers FC team. This role is pivotal in leading and managing various football programs and relationships with schools across Western Sydney. The Coordinator will be responsible for overseeing government-funded projects, paid school projects, and free in-school projects, contributing significantly to the club’s community engagement and sports development objectives.
Responsibilities
- Lead and manage school football programs, ensuring effective delivery across different streams (government-funded, paid, and free projects).
- Create and maintain essential documentation and reports, ensuring accuracy and compliance.
- Develop relationships with schools, school principal networks, and operational-directorates in Western Sydney to facilitate programs effectively.
- Develop relationships with Department of Education (DoE) project leads to ensure compliance across government funded programs.
- Manage a Content Management System (CMS) effectively for program tracking and reporting.
- Collaborate with the Community Department to enhance fan engagement and promote inclusion in the community.
- Drive the club’s multicultural, Indigenous, All-Abilities, and Female Focused programs in schools, enhancing diversity and participation.
- Achieve set targets related to school engagement, participant numbers, and revenue generation.
- Ensure strict adherence to child safety, data privacy, and governance reporting standards across all programs.
- Supervise one direct report and provide guidance to two indirect reports, fostering a collaborative team environment.
